FATALITY
Chilean woman dies in jump after parachute failure in SP
She jumped at around 5:40 pm last Saturday (26)
Published on October 28, 2024 at 1:03 pm
Carolina Munoz Kennedy, 40 years old Credit: Reproduction
A Chilean man died after parachuting in the Boituva region, in the interior of São Paulo. According to information, the reserve parachute she was using at the time of the accident did not work during the fall.
Carolina Munõz Kennedy, 40 years old, was known as Carito. She jumped at around 5:40 pm last Saturday (26), but the reserve parachute she was using did not work, for reasons still unknown, according to testimony from one of the teachers at the parachuting school responsible for operating the jumps.
According to information from Metrópoles, the company responsible for Carolina’s flight published a note of condolence on social media, lamenting the parachutist’s death. Carito was characterized as having “an easy smile” and “an immense love for animals and human beings”.
The case was registered at the Boituva Police Station as an accidental death.
